Unintentional epidural administration of thiamylal. Case report

Abstract
Background And Objectives:
A 36-year-old woman was scheduled for surgery of bicornuate uterus under epidural anesthesia.
Methods:
As a test dose, 3 mL 2.5% thiamylal was injected unintentionally through the epidural catheter instead of 1.5% lidocaine with 15 micrograms epinephrine.
Results:
Immediately the patient complained of burning pain in the low back area. Administrations of 10 mL 2% lidocaine without epinephrine and 10 mL normal saline containing hydrocortisone 100 mg were performed through the epidural catheter.
Conclusions:
The patient recovered without permanent neurologic sequelae.
